It definitely will work with an 'element' that angular passes through. So this article is about how to get rid of that blank space and customize grid height dynamically based on record count. @SidhNor thanks for the suggestion; I actually tried using modalClass (and dialogClass, but i'm using ui-angular-.1.0), and while it looks like the class is now being applied, the directive isn't being compiled to the modal/dialog. Angular Data Grid Responsive Design. Top 2. implement Read more or less button link with size height. To get started, let's create an empty dialog component. so simply, lets follow bellow example to done with getting div width and height. Data fetching part is working fine for us. Also, specify the width and add the background-color property. Step 2: Create Component File. If you need help on this step, just drop a comment below. The components have no relationship. Set the flex property for the "row header", "row content", and "row footer" classes, separately. But now using CSS we can set height without making header and footer height fixed or using jquery function. Run the command ng new {your-app-name} Open the new project in your editor of choice. It includes only the padding applied to the element and excludes the borders, margins or horizontal scrollbars. Before we start, make sure you have installed the Angular CLI v9. child-component-2.html <div [style.height.px]="actualHeight"></div> child-component-2.ts this.actualHeight = window.innerHeight - 269; Here you can add, subtract, multiply and divide any length unit together with each other to get a different output result. We have also prepared a sample based on your requirement. Nested DIVs and CSS Float Tutorial. for ( var x = 0; x < 9; x++) { var board = document.createElement ( 'div' ); board.className = "containernew" ; var container = document . Run the following command to generate custom directive in Angular 13 app. Step 2- Create Component File. Step 3: Update TypeScript Template. More specifically, their height starts at the top offset position of the element inside the window and ends at the end of the window. Angular has two excellent directives that allow us to dynamically set styles on any element and toggle CSS classes. Here are the steps to implement. It uses mathematical expression by this property we can set the height content div area dynamically. We are going to look at a simple example below. If you specify more than one class then separate those by spaces. display: grid: Defines the element as a grid-container; grid-template-rows: Defines a maximum number of rows and row-size; grid-auto-flow: column: Tells the grid to create a new column (Instead of a new row) when it runs out of space vertically. Let's take some screenshots with less data, so you can understand better. Touch device users can explore by touch or with swipe . We use css property height: calc ( 100% - div_height ); Here, Calc is a function. Hello my friends, welcome back to my blog and today in this blog post, I am going to tell you, Angular 12 HighCharts with Dynamic Data Working Example. Pinterest. This reference is usually obtained by specifying some template . But now using CSS we can set height without making header and footer height fixed or using jquery function. May 15, 2020 - Angularjs Calculate Dynamically Height and width Element Size,angular 6 set div height dynamically,angularjs get div height,javascript get div. Step 1: Create React Project. change: changeHeight }); function changeHeight(e) { $ ( "#scrollView" ).height For a service, we'll use we use RendererFactory2 to get a Renderer2 instance. Let's . Using Renderer2 is a simple way of listening to the window's events. Method 1: Using Renderer2. Output: Before clicking the button: After clicking the button: Method 2: Using clientHeight property: The clientHeight property of an element is a read-only property and used to return the height of an element in pixels. Once you have the right version of the Angular CLI installed, follow these steps: Open your terminal of choice. The best thing about the calc function is that you can combine different units. I have tried creating multiple divs inside div,but its not working. Attribute binding in Angular helps you set values for attributes directly. Step 3-Get Dynamic Screen Dimension On Resize. What is Lorem Ipsum? The "flex" value of the display property displays an element as a block-level-flex container. Step 3 - Configuration Properties. Step 4: Display Window Size. Preview: src/app/app.component.html f.style.height = s; s = f.contentWindow.document.body.scrollHeight + "px"; f.style.height = s;} a) putting the onload to the iframe, the iframe re-configures the height everytime the iframe loads. You will have to get the height directly. Step 2: Create Angular App. Now we have records list based on custom paging. Set the height and margin for the <html> and <body> elements. Here's how to dynamically create a div, set it's id property, and append it to the body element in an Angular service or component. Step 2 - Installation of React SizeMe package.
Could be something in my CSS, but i'm having a rough time figuring out what it could be. In the example above, we use the "flex" value of the display property, the "column" value of the flex-direction property, the "center" value of the align-items property and the "center" value of the justify-content property. Step 1: Create a Model file. Here, i have two sections : 1. Step 2: Download Angular Project. Best Regards
Conclusion. Working Demo at StackBlitz.
The components have no relationship. Inside the function, we need to perform the following tasks: Clear the container. element.style.color = 'blue'. Angular 13 Detect Width and Height of Screen on Window Resize Example. Set the float property to "left" and the height to 100% for the "left". Added ngClass directive to long text div, ngClass directive allows you to add CSS class dynamically based on angular expressions. Hello my friends, welcome back to my blog and today in this blog post, I am going to tell you, Angular 12 HighCharts with Dynamic Data Working Example. I've written a component that smoothly animates the height of projected content if that content changes. This directive can dynamically add or change the class name of an element within your component. JavaScript Code Place the following JavaScript code at the bottom of the web page, just before the closing </body> tag. In child-component-2 ,I need to get the height of this ngb-alert to make dynamic height calculation on the screen.If it exists,I need to subtract it from window.innerheight. For example: <p ng-class="className className2>Content here </p>.
Guys with this post we will do below things: HighCharts with Angular 12.; Dynamic chart data from PHP in Angular 12.; Guys here you can see working video: We have validated your reported query. Set the height, border, font-size, font-weight, and color properties for the "container". The problem is, if A's data having more than two lines means we get a allingment issue for B's table Using Element.clientHeight property In one of my recent article on dynamic component instantiation Here is what you need to know about dynamic components in Angular I've shown the way how to add a child component to the parent component view dynamically. The tooltip content can be changed dynamically using the AJAX request. Mappinglink. Copy Code. Step 1: Pull the pdfviewer-server image from Docker Hub. Bottom After loading, Bottom. you might need to auto scroll bottom or click to button scroll bottom for chat . Create a component . ; Change the pageSize by using the pageSize method of the dataSource. Angular-2. Bash. container.component.css. It uses mathematical expression by this property we can set the height content div area dynamically. The cli will add the component to the same folder as the module. Here, i have two sections : 1. It's time to have fun. In this Angular 8/9 tutorial, we will understand how to use ElementRef getting element reference in the document or HTML template as we use document.getElementById () method in vanilla javascript. In case button is to be shown, parent div height would be more than div height when button is not to be shown. Description. Top 2. Bottom After loading, Bottom section is hidden with only Arrow icon. Step 1: Set Up Angular CLI. Here I am creating some dynamic data accordingly for making this article easy to understand. Component properties and logic maps directly into HTML attributes and the browser's event system.
// Character.ts export default class Character { actor_name: String ; character_name: String ; gender: String ; status: String ; } In the controller, declare the isReadMore boolean value in typescript code with a true default value Setting image using external CSS. Step 5: Start React App. var panelHeight = document.getElementById(nameOfMessageBoxWindow).clientHeight; var panelWidth = document.getElementById(nameOfMessageBoxWindow).clientWidth; In the useEffect callback, we use ref.current?.clientHeight to get the div's height in pixels. AngularDynamicHeight In this tutorial, i have explained how you an dynamically set height of a div of component depending on other div of component. Let's learn in detail now: Renderer2, the successor to Renderer is part of the Angular Standard Library and is injectable into components via dependency injection.It provides an API to interact with and update the DOM. Thanks to directives like ngClass and ngStyle, it's almost always possible to style text without resorting to setting CSS properties in TypeScript code as in:. Attribute binding. Explore. In this tutorial, i have explained how you an dynamically set height of a div of component depending on other div of component. docker pull syncfusion/pdfviewer-server. Is there any way to create multiple divs dynamically using Angular2? This component will consist of a white dialog area, while the rest of the screen is blurred. The AJAX request should be made within the beforeRender event of the tooltip. angular-scroll I don't want the GridPagerItem and GridCommandItem to scroll horizontally with the rest of the grid Get and set scroll position of an element Hi, Im trying to make a angular component with only horizontal scrolling on mouse activity Document Includes User Manual User Manual Part 1 of 2 Document Includes User Manual User Manual . The responsive features of the Kendo UI Grid for Angular are: Responsive columns Based on the viewport width, the visibility of the Grid columns toggles. Added ngClass directive to long text div, ngClass directive allows you to add CSS class dynamically based on angular expressions. Step 4 - Usage of SizeMe in React App. Of course, there is no possibility of data binding. When the auto-complete results are available, use the up and down arrows to review and Enter to select. Steps to Complete: 1 Angular provided built-in directive, and it helps in adding or removing CSS classes on an HTML element You can add styles conditionally to an element, hence creating a dynamically styled element Angular: Dynamically inserting SVG into an element By Chris Mendez On June 17, 2017 - 4 min read I recently launched a single-page . Styling HTML with ngClass and ngStyle. Step 4- Update App Js File. When we use the "column" value of the flex-direction property, items are . Interactive web designs require elements with dynamic height that depends on their location in the window viewport. ; In our example, each row will take up 1 fraction of the space. In this tutorial, i have explained how you an dynamically set height of a div of component depending on other div of component. Get iconCss dynamically in treeview in Angular TreeView component. Step 2: Create the docker-compose.yml file with the following code in your file system. How to Get Width and Height of Screen on Window Resize in Angular. Here, i have two sections : 1. Here we add the crazy class to elements with the help of custom directive. This arrow icon is used to show and hide the content of bottom section. For this method, if you pass the id of the tree node, it returns the corresponding node information, or otherwise the overall tree nodes information will be returned. document.getElementById("p2"). Search: Angular Scroll To Dynamic Element. It is the preferred way to interact with the DOM that is also SSR (Server Side Rendering) compatible.. Step 3: Get Responsive Screen Size. You may also use an object as the expression. Therefore, to dynamically change the values we need to change the properties. A custom element hosts an Angular component, providing a bridge between the data and logic defined in the component and standard DOM APIs. This arrow icon is used to show and hide the content of bottom section. When you hover over the icons, its respective data will be retrieved dynamically and then . In this example, i will give you very simple example of how to scroll to top of div element in angular application. To get a rendered component height with React, we can use the element's clientHeight property. Bottom After loading, Bottom section is hidden with only Arrow icon. Set the border for the "box.row". In the best case, we would find that element by id like this: const element = document.getElementById ('divToStyle') Afterward, we could use the JavaScript DOM-API to assign a style. Absolutely yes! Guys with this post we will do below things: HighCharts with Angular 12. $ ( "#scrollView" ).kendoScrollView ( { . Dynamic chart data from PHP in Angular 12. Step 4: Update App Js File. I suggest you can create another div with more height to package the dynamical div so that we can get the fixed value instead of the dynamical one. Step 3: Get Dynamic Screen Dimension on Resize. Inside the src >> app folder, create one file called Character.ts file and add the following code inside it. If we inspect the p tag in our example code above, we would see that it has a property called style. The style property is an object as well and has all the CSS properties as its properties. Step 1- Create New React Project. we will use ngStyle for set dynamically style in angular 8. we can use ngStyle attribute in angular templates. Cross-Browser Hoo-Hah For each element I want to be able to expand the product details dynamically - when they click on the div show more details, the div containing the product details is shown - when the user presses the button again, the div that contains the details are hidden MatSelect API is robust having vast capabilities, but there's an issue .
- Pho-4-ever Webb City Menu
- Roman Reigns Vs Brock Lesnar Money In The Bank
- Ed Sheeran Concert 2022 Near Me
- Low Fat Feta Cheese Nutrition
- Nzd/usd Forecast Tradingview
- Wor Racquetball Huntington Beach
- Limber Up Onitsuka Tiger
- Christmas Party Names 2021
- Human Placental Lactogen Insulin
- Insurance Company Search
- Wow Internet Outage Royal Oak
- Lord Michael Ashcroft Family
- Krisflyer Registration Promotion Singapore
- Ovid Metamorphoses 15 Latin